NRS 390.800 - Limitation on administration; periodic review.

NV Rev Stat § 390.800 (2019) (N/A)
Copy with citation
Copy as parenthetical citation

1. In addition to any other test, examination or assessment required by state or federal law, the board of trustees of each school district may require the administration of district-wide tests, examinations and assessments that the board of trustees determines are vital to measure the achievement and progress of pupils. In making this determination, the board of trustees shall consider any applicable findings and recommendations of the Legislative Committee on Education.

2. The tests, examinations and assessments required pursuant to subsection 1 must be limited to those which can be demonstrated to provide a direct benefit to pupils or which are used by teachers to improve instruction and the achievement of pupils.

3. The board of trustees of each school district and the State Board shall periodically review the tests, examinations and assessments administered to pupils to ensure that the time taken from instruction to conduct a test, examination or assessment is warranted because it is still accomplishing its original purpose.

(Added to NRS by 2007, 773; R temp. 2009, 2341; A 2011, 806; 2013, 3269) — (Substituted in revision for NRS 389.006)
